Which term refers to the ability of a species or organism to survive and reproduce?

Biology
2 answers:
Effectus [21]4 years ago
8 0
Answer: Fitness

-----

To help you remember this, think fitness for us is being healthy, staying active, etc. Usually if you're fitter, you live longer and feel better. In biology, it's kind of the same idea, but make sure you remember its not just surviving, but also reproducing!
